DirkN 0 Posted December 27, 2012 Share Posted December 27, 2012 When I made a flight to CYXE the Descent Preparation CL was stuck on item Baro reference. The copilot was repeating this item until after landing. The Vol. 6 manual says on page 42 point 208: The QNH value of the arrival airport will automatically be set by the copilot. I wonder how the copilot determines this value. Is this automatically derived from ATIS ? Is it important to set the QNH to in Hg when flying in Canada in order for the checklist to work ? Mik75 30 Posted December 28, 2012 Share Posted December 28, 2012 The Copilot simply dials in the setting you have entered into the approach page of the MCDU (where you also enter the flap setting for landing, the DH or MDA etc.)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Cpais 8 Posted December 28, 2012 Share Posted December 28, 2012 The QNH will be changed from STD at the selected TL by the copilot, however the approach page (which has all the information used by the copilot), must be filled in.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Deputy Sheriffs Hanse 216 Posted January 6, 2013 Deputy Sheriffs Share Posted January 6, 2013 Hi, the value dialed in by copilot comes from FSX and is the same value than pressing "B" on the keyboard. So if you do not use the copilot just press "B" when the action is required..... Hanse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
